Many People Want To Eat Right For Their Blood Type But Dont Know How To Get Started

Make a weeks menu and the list of foods you can have and make up a go to list of things that you could have for breakfast , lunch , and dinner and snacks...if you have favorite foods try to translate it to your allowed food ingredients to make it...for example corn chip and salsa...the recipe for chips is to the right of this and that replaces the traditional corn chips that we usually would have eaten...many baked things can be replaced exchanging the flours out for grains you can have ...this requires you to think a bit more and plan ahead...so for my breakfast I have anywhere from brown rice grits to kamut cereal to brown rice krispies w/ 1/2 a banana or fresh blueberries...toasted Ezekiel bread or english muffins...almond butter and 1/2 of banana......eggs n toast turkey bacon (trader joes no nitrate or nitrites or msg preservatives etc )...for lunch i almost always have a spinach salad...dinner totally depends on whats going on ...from steaks to hamburgers to turkey burgers ...meatloaf...meatballs, sausage w spaghetti sauce w  brown rice noodles / spaghetti ...remember no wheat so always noodles should be brown rice well they have white rice noodles but go the extra mile to be healthy I have brown rice ones... my sides for steaks can be 2 veggies or special veggie root chips (trader joes) and sweet potato chips also from TJ's ...roasted sweet potatoes....roasted veggies ...steamed veggies...sauteed veggies ... I eat out sometimes and I go to places I know I can figure out what to get...chipolte...rumbis...a hamburger out you can swap out the bun with your own I have done that and I have also brought my own tortillas and chips to eat out mexican...I don't eat any white potatoes anymore so french fries are out but rumbis has sweet potato fries to go w the hamburgers there...chickfila is ok i get the grilled chicken garden salad w balsamic vinegrette using only half of the dressing...that should give you and idea of what I eat...Happy Eating ...Coach Sandra
